Track Bahamas Post Package

Bahamas Post

Bahamas Post is the national postal service of The Bahamas, responsible for mail and package delivery both domestically and internationally. It operates under the Ministry of Transport and Housing, providing essential services to residents and businesses across the islands.

What Does Bahamas Post Tracking Number Look Like?

Bahamas Post tracking numbers typically consist of a combination of letters and numbers. The exact format may vary depending on the type of service used. For instance, international tracking numbers often start with two letters, followed by nine digits, and end with "GB" (e.g., AA123456789GB).

International Shipping with Bahamas Post

Bahamas Post offers international shipping services to numerous countries. The shipping fees and delivery times depend on the destination and the type of service selected. For example, shipping to the United States may cost $25.00 per kilogram, while shipping to Canada, the Caribbean, and South America may cost $27.50 per kilogram. Delivery times vary based on the destination country and the service chosen. Why Is My Bahamas Post Package Delayed or Stuck?

Several factors can cause delays or issues with Bahamas Post packages, including: Customs Processing: International shipments may experience delays due to customs inspections. Address Issues: Incorrect or incomplete addresses can lead to delivery problems. Weather Conditions: Severe weather can disrupt transportation and delivery schedules. High Shipping Volumes: During peak seasons, such as holidays, increased mail volumes can cause delays. For specific information about your package, contact Bahamas Post customer service.
